Primary referenceComparison of complexes formed by a crustacean and a vertebrate trypsin with bovine pancreatic trypsin inhibitor - the key to achieving extreme stability?, Molnar T, Voros J, Szeder B, Takats K, Kardos J, Katona G, Graf L, FEBS J. 2013 Aug 22. doi: 10.1111/febs.12491. PMID:24034223
